The mountains of Ko Chang are still covered with rain forest, so the weather tends to be a bit more unpredictable than Phuket where the forests have been cleared and coconut trees been planted instead..
During the rainy season expect one or two heavy downpours  everyday. They usually last 30-45 minutes. There are exeptions, of course, when you're trapped for hours. I visit Ko Chang for more than twenty years and it happened only one or two times.
